Pool ground preparation services involve readying the area where a new swimming pool will be installed. This process typically includes clearing the site of existing vegetation, leveling the terrain, and ensuring a solid, stable foundation. Proper ground preparation helps prevent future issues such as shifting, cracking, or settling that can compromise the pool’s structure. Experienced contractors use specialized equipment and techniques to create a smooth, even surface, making sure that the ground is suitable for supporting the weight and size of the pool.
One of the main problems ground preparation addresses is uneven or unstable soil, which can lead to structural problems once the pool is in use. Without proper preparation, a pool may develop cracks, leaks, or even shift out of position over time. Additionally, poorly prepared ground can cause drainage issues, leading to standing water or erosion around the pool area. Local contractors can assess the soil conditions, recommend necessary improvements, and perform the work needed to create a secure base, helping to avoid costly repairs and ensuring the longevity of the pool.
Ground preparation is often needed on properties that have uneven terrain, soft or clay-heavy soil, or areas with significant vegetation or debris. The overview below groups typical Pool Ground Preparation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Blaine,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or ground preparation tasks, such as leveling or patching, generally range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and condition of the existing ground.
Standard Installation - For standard pool ground prep, including excavation and grading for new pools, local contractors often charge between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ger or more complex projects can push costs higher but remain less common.
Full Ground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of existing ground material can typically range from $3,500 to $7,000, with more extensive projects potentially exceeding this range. These are less frequent and usually involve larger, more detailed work.
Additional Factors - Costs can vary based on soil conditions, access difficulty, and project size. Many projects fall into the middle of these ranges, but unique site conditions can influence the final price significantly.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in preparing the ground for a pool installation? Ground preparation typically includes clearing the area, leveling the surface, and ensuring proper soil compaction to create a stable base for the pool.
Why is proper ground preparation important before installing a pool? Proper preparation helps prevent shifting or settling of the pool, reduces the risk of leaks, and ensures safety and longevity of the structure.
What types of soil conditions may require special preparation? Areas with clay, loose soil, or uneven terrain may need additional grading, soil stabilization, or excavation to create a suitable base.
How do local contractors handle ground leveling for pools? They typically use specialized equipment to level and grade the site, ensuring a flat, stable surface that meets the specific requirements of the pool type.
